| Aspect | Detail |
|---|---|
| Chemical Name | 2 Methyl Cyclohexanone |
| Molecular Formula | C7H14O |
| Molecular Weight | 114.19 g/mol |
| Appearance | Colorless Liquid |
| Boiling Point | 164-165 °C |
| Applications | Solvent in Paints, Coatings, and Chemical Synthesis |
| Economic Benefits | Cost-effective compared to other solvents |
| Environmental Impact | Lower VOC emissions |
| Storage Conditions | Store in a cool, dry place |
